Close-Grip Barbell Bench Press

The Close-Grip Barbell Bench Press is a powerful exercise aimed at strengthening your upper body, with a special focus on the triceps and chest muscles. This variation of the traditional bench press places more emphasis on the triceps, providing a more intense workout for these muscles.

Execution

  1. 1
    Lie on a flat bench and grip the barbell with a narrow grip, approximately shoulder-width apart.
  2. 2
    Lift the barbell out of the rack and hold it directly above your chest with your arms extended.
  3. 3
    Inhale and slowly lower the barbell toward your chest while keeping your elbows close to your body.
  4. 4
    Press the barbell upward to the starting position while exhaling, focusing on contracting your triceps.

Benefits

This exercise not only strengthens your triceps and chest but also improves overall upper-body stability and can help improve your performance in other pressing exercises.

Common Mistakes

  • ! Holding the barbell too wide: Keep your grip narrow to maintain the focus on the triceps.
  • ! Allowing the elbows to flare too far out: Keep your elbows close to your body to maximize effectiveness and prevent injuries.
  • ! Lowering the barbell too quickly: A controlled movement provides better muscle activation and less risk of injury.

Key Muscles

The primary muscle groups trained with the Close-Grip Barbell Bench Press are the triceps and chest muscles. The shoulders and upper-back muscles are also lightly engaged as secondary muscles.

Possible Alternatives

If you want to adjust the intensity of the exercise, you can vary it with the following alternatives:

  • Close-Grip Dumbbell Press: This creates a greater stabilization challenge for your muscles.
  • Incline Close-Grip Bench Press: Changing the angle of the bench places more emphasis on the upper part of your chest muscles.
